Management of SACCOs

Learning Objectives

  • Governance and Leadership: Explore the roles and responsibilities of SACCO boards, management staff, and committees in decision-making and governance.
  • Credit Administration and Risk Management: Understand the process of evaluating loan applications, managing credit risk, and ensuring timely loan repayments.
  • Savings Mobilization Techniques: Explore strategies for encouraging members to save regularly, including promoting different savings products and setting attractive interest rates.
  • Understanding Cooperative Principles: Learn about the cooperative principles that guide SACCOs, such as voluntary and open membership, democratic control, and member economic participation.
  • Member Relationship Building: Learn how to build strong relationships with SACCO members through effective communication, personalized service, and member education.
  • Financial Management and Reporting: Gain insights into financial management practices, including budgeting, financial statements, and auditing.

Remember, SACCO Management is not only about financial transactions but also about fostering a sense of community and trust among members.

Learning Agenda

SACCO Management is the process of managing a Savings and Credit Cooperative Organization (SACCO), which is a type of financial institution that provides savings and credit services to its members.
